Meet a burgeoning tribe of young Singaporean tea enthusiasts as they demonstrate the detailed and elegant art of tea-making in the finals of an annual challenge run by tea retailer Pek Sin Choon, one of Singapore's oldest tea merchants with roots going back to 1925.

Pek Sin Choon

Pek Sin Choon has a history of close to 100 years in Singapore. The Company is one of the remaining few tea merchants in Singapore which blended their own tea leaves using the traditional method.
